Sperm Sperm, n.[Contr. fr. spermaceti.] Spermaceti. [1913 Webster]

{Sperm oil}, a fatty oil found as a liquid, with spermaceti, in the head cavities of the sperm whale.

{Sperm whale}. (Zo["o]l.) See in the Vocabulary. [1913 Webster]
